Output 1cec9007babfd28893c2188a5c273b61f6d5ef75e0f2e24815f66b037e888583:1

value
74267600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e8e22a9e50916b81451bb26dff5a550834d6b2 OP_EQUAL
address
34xtZHTGRNKLTVYX52UvdVnyExiZ6px2yx
transaction
1cec9007babfd28893c2188a5c273b61f6d5ef75e0f2e24815f66b037e888583
spent
true